Durability and Maintenance

Sterling silver is a very classic and durable option which does not go out of style. It is however a softer metal which means it is more prone to scratching and tarnish. It also requires regular care and proper storage in order to keep its look. If you are into low maintenance pieces that also can take a bit of a beating then stainless steel may be what you are looking for.

Style and Appearance

Sterling silver brings a style that fits formal or old-school events; it shines naturally and gives a fine, smooth finish for classic looks. People enjoy that elegant touch, choosing silver for its strong history and clean appearance. With stainless steel, you get more of a modern and worksite feel that matches current trends, so it is often used for men’s fashion too. Understanding Where to Buy Ethyl Alcohol Safely

Ethyl alcohol serves several functions such as in medicine, industry, and food processes. Safe and legal purchasing of ethyl alcohol is important to receive a product matching your needs. The following guide describes where to find ethyl alcohol and what to think about before buying.

Popular Sources for Purchasing Ethyl Alcohol

Availability of ethyl alcohol changes with how you plan to use it. Pharmacies and stores selling medical supplies offer options used for disinfection and antibacterial work. Most products in those places give you around 70 percent alcohol by volume which is standard for cleaning. Chemical supply companies sell to labs and factories and carry different grades of ethyl alcohol. You often must show credentials or proof of your business to buy large amounts from chemical vendors. Checking the type and grade from industrial suppliers is key to match your specific application.

Online Retailers and Specialized Stores

More people use online stores when asking where to buy ethyl alcohol. Chemical or lab supply sellers online often list ethanol as high-purity, or show labels like food grade or pharmaceutical grade. Verifying online sellers through ratings, certificates, and reviews helps prevent unsafe or fake purchases. Shops for brewing, food creation, or cosmetics may stock versions meant for those niche needs, including formats allowed in food making.

What Is Food Grade Alcohol? Many ask what is food grade alcohol when looking for use in foods or drinks. Food grade alcohol, known as ethanol, must meet safety and purity rules made by regulatory groups. No dangerous additives or other substances can be present in food grade alcohol. Common places to find this type include production of tinctures, extracts, or food flavors. Food grade alcohol is allowed for eating or drinking, unlike industrial or denatured alcohol which is not safe for this.Where you buy ethyl alcohol depends on how you plan to use it. What Is Organic Alcohol?

Producers produce organic alcohol solely from crops that are produced under organic conditions with no chemical fertilizers or synthetic pesticides. Farms that supply material for this alcohol must follow detailed organic standards for all operations. Organic ethyl alcohol often replaces traditional alcohol because many believe it to be a cleaner and more eco-aware product.

Benefits of Choosing Organic Alcohol

Reducing chemical exposure is what drives many people to select organic alcohol, because it avoids chemical leftovers from non-organic farming. Choosing organic farming also helps soil life and more plant and animal types, making organic alcohol a choice that supports the earth’s systems. Both personal buyers and business users may seek organic alcohol to match with eco-friendly concerns and practices.

Environmental Impact of Organic Alcohol Production

When companies make organic alcohol, their operations usually have less impact on the land and the climate than standard alcohol production. These producers avoid chemical sprays and fertilizers which stops soil and water from becoming polluted. Organic fields build up healthy ground by using natural cycles and letting small living things grow actively under the soil. More life in the fields, like insects and small animals, appears because of these careful farming methods. Some organic alcohol facilities also make use of green energy and manage their water use in line with best practices for nature. Supporting organic alcohol allows people to back farming styles that care about the balance with nature and try not to add much to environmental harm.

Vintage Jewelry Repair and Maintenance

Vintage wedding jewelry can wear out. Some pieces may need fixing or cleaning. If you choose an antique piece, have a jeweler check it first. A jeweler who knows vintage pieces will spot problems like loose stones or weak settings. Fix these before your wedding. Restoration may include cleaning, polishing and reattaching loose gems or clasps. Bringing old jewelry back to life means the piece will be around for future generations too. Find an experienced jeweler; mishandling will ruin the value of your treasure. Vintage jewelry needs to be looked after so it stays nice over time. Store it in a safe dry place, away from light and heat and don’t wear it while exercising or swimming! Regular gentle cleanings will keep everything shiny too.
